Determine the equation of the line perpendicular to y = 1/5x – 7 and passes through the point (-3,6).

Respuesta :

rijarafiquee
rijarafiquee rijarafiquee
  • 18-06-2021

Answer:

y = -5x - 9

Step-by-step explanation:

y = -5x + b

6 = -5(-3) + b

6 = 15 + b

b = -9
